美团曝光两“骑手”摆拍哭诉视频造假:一人未跑过单,另一人未注册
Feng Huang Wang· 2025-06-19 23:10
Group 1 - The core viewpoint of the articles is that Meituan has responded to viral videos depicting delivery riders in distress, asserting that these videos are staged and the individuals involved are not actual Meituan riders [1][2] - Meituan identified that the account "陌林努力中" registered as a rider on June 15 but had never completed any orders, while the account "红孩儿.命硬" had never registered as a rider [1] - Both accounts are linked to similar narratives of hardship and fabricated stories to create a persona of struggling workers, which has raised skepticism among viewers [1] Group 2 - Meituan has gathered evidence against these accounts for misleading the public and is considering legal action to protect its reputation [2] - The company has collaborated with law enforcement and internet regulatory bodies to address over 30 similar cases of false portrayal since 2024, leading to penalties for the responsible parties [2] - Previous incidents of staged videos, including those depicting violence against riders and false narratives involving riders in distress, have been classified as malicious marketing by authorities [2]

苹果高管回忆芯片开发之路:自研是场豪赌 未来或用AI
Feng Huang Wang· 2025-06-19 01:59
Group 1 - Apple aims to leverage generative AI to accelerate the design of custom chips, which are crucial for its devices [1] - The comments were made by Apple's hardware technology senior vice president, Johny Srouji, during a speech in Belgium while receiving an award from Imec, a semiconductor research organization [1] - Srouji reviewed Apple's journey in developing custom chips, starting from the A4 chip for the iPhone in 2010 to the latest chips used in Mac computers and Vision Pro headsets [1] Group 2 - A key lesson learned by Apple is the necessity of using advanced tools for chip design, including the latest chip design software from Electronic Design Automation (EDA) companies [2] - The EDA industry is dominated by two major players, Cadence and Synopsys, who are competing to integrate AI technology into their products [2] - Srouji emphasized that generative AI has significant potential to complete more design work in a shorter time, greatly enhancing productivity [2] Group 3 - Another critical lesson from Apple's experience in self-developed chips is the importance of commitment, as demonstrated when Apple transitioned its Mac computers from Intel chips to its own without any contingency plans [2] - The shift to Apple’s custom chips for Macs was described as a gamble, with no backup plans or dual-chip strategies, requiring substantial software adaptation efforts [2]
华为轮值董事长徐直军:骑手、主播是重要的新用户群体
Feng Huang Wang· 2025-06-18 07:28
Group 1 - The core viewpoint of the article emphasizes that the telecom market, while entering a mature phase, is not stagnant but is experiencing a critical period of demand transformation and technological iteration [1] - The industry needs to return to a focus on "growth" by accurately identifying the differentiated needs of emerging user groups, the diversification of terminal forms, and the dynamic migration of user behaviors to uncover growth opportunities [1] - New user groups, new terminal applications, and new user behaviors are creating entirely new demand characteristics, with examples such as the rapidly expanding delivery and live streaming industries [1] Group 2 - The global delivery rider population is expected to reach 160 million by 2030, representing high-value users for operators with an ARPU 1.6 times that of ordinary users [1] - The professional live streamer group is projected to reach 130 million by 2030, with an ARPU four times that of ordinary users [1] - There is a significant gap between current consumption levels and potential in the high-definition video market, with only 22% of mobile video traffic being 1080P or higher [1] Group 3 - In the development of smart connected vehicles, it is predicted that by 2025, the penetration rate of 5G vehicle networking in China's passenger car sales will reach 30%, gradually increasing to 95% from 2026 to 2030 [2] - Current challenges in 5G vehicle networking include issues related to 5G intellectual property rights, intense price competition, and inconsistent user experiences [2] - The company calls for collaborative efforts within the mobile communications industry, under the GSMA organization, to address 5G IPR issues, with Huawei expressing its willingness to fully support these initiatives [2]
苹果躲过一劫:21亿 LTE专利侵权赔偿案被推翻
Feng Huang Wang· 2025-06-18 06:45
Group 1 - Apple won a significant legal victory in a long-standing patent lawsuit against Optis Wireless Technology, as the U.S. Court of Appeals for the Federal Circuit overturned a lower court ruling that required Apple to pay $300 million in damages [1][2] - The case was sent back to Texas for retrial due to flawed jury instructions in the previous trial, marking the second time that a nine-figure patent damages award to Optis has been overturned [1][2] - Optis, a Texas-based intellectual property management company, initially sued Apple in 2019, claiming that iPhones and other Apple products infringed on patents related to LTE wireless standards [1] Group 2 - In the second trial, the jury reduced the damages to $300 million, but Apple appealed and won, with the appellate court focusing on the jury's decision-making process rather than the specific amount of damages [2] - The appellate court noted that the lower court's judge improperly combined multiple patents into a single infringement issue, which deprived Apple of the right to a unanimous verdict on each legal claim against it [2] - An Optis spokesperson expressed confidence that the court would determine a fair compensation amount for the patents critical to enabling high-speed connections for millions of Apple devices [2]

字节跳动AI技术助力比亚迪兆瓦闪充突破 双方将共建联合实验室
Feng Huang Wang· 2025-06-18 05:47
Core Insights - ByteDance and BYD announced a collaboration to deepen the application of AI for Science technology in lithium battery research through the establishment of a joint laboratory [1][2] - BYD's recently launched megawatt fast-charging battery can achieve "charging in 5 minutes for a range of 400 kilometers," with significant contributions from ByteDance's BAMBOO AI model framework [1] - The BAMBOO framework utilizes machine learning to predict key performance indicators of electrolyte solutions, significantly reducing the research and development cycle [1][2] Technology Overview - BAMBOO-MLFF is a machine learning force field designed for liquid-phase organic small molecule design, integrating molecular dynamics algorithms with AI model network design [2] - BAMBOO-Mix is a formulation generation and prediction model that can generate potential formulations based on constraints and quickly predict properties of given formulations [2] - The BAMBOO framework effectively addresses the challenges of high computational costs associated with traditional quantum mechanics simulations while maintaining accuracy [2] Industry Implications - The collaboration exemplifies the deep application value of AI technology in traditional manufacturing, potentially providing new development pathways for technological innovation in the power battery industry [3]
